An ‘elements‘ (ether-jazz) edition that breaks all the rules*. Revolving around Dylan Howe‘s interpretation of David Bowie‘s ‘Low‘ & ‘Heroes‘ ambient tracks, Subterranean: New Designs on Bowie’s Berlin, the challenge was to make a stand-alone Jazz mix, while reflecting Howe’s interpretation & bringing it out within the scope of the other selected tracks.

elements 7 (a + b) | 82:04 / 77:48
A 2 parter (remixed from the 2005 original & inspired by a recent interview by Rick Beato with Pat Metheny), that grew out of my use of Mr. Metheny within this current ‘elements’ series; though he often gets a skewed rap as a “Smooth Jazz” artist, I’d bet that (like track 13 from the Frankenstein Mix concept) more people are into his stuff than care to admit it…and…the man can play!
As I started digging through the stacks, I unearthed fifteen albums by either Metheny, his Group or side projects (some of which I haven’t played in several years). I attempted to keep the ratio of Jazz to South American-influenced beats fairly even…and started cutting so many songs that it eventually grew into a double set. Unfortunately I couldn’t use anything off ‘The Falcon & the Snowman’ soundtrack or ‘Zero Tolerance for Silence’, as they just didn’t fit the “feel” of this double-shot.
My favorite of all the albums represented herein has to be ‘Question & Answer’, recorded with Dave Holland on bass and Roy Haynes on drums; I can set that one on ‘repeat’ @ the office and go just about all day long.
Mixed, including spaces between many of the compositions, so as to enhance f-l-o-w (vs. chronology) with a new track added to the project from the 2005 original mix.
